Building a Capsule Commute Wardrobe

The modern professional's morning is a race against the clock, and nothing derails a calm start like a closet full of options that refuse to cooperate. A minimalist commute wardrobe solves this problem quietly and permanently. By curating a small rotation of high-quality, interchangeable pieces, you remove decision fatigue before it even begins. Think two pairs of tailored trousers, three breathable tops, one structured blazer, and a reliable coat in a forgiving neutral tone. Each item should pair with at least three others, creating dozens of distinct outfits from a fraction of the closet space. The goal here is not deprivation but clarity. When everything you own earns its place, getting dressed becomes a five-minute ritual rather than a daily negotiation with your wardrobe.

The Power of Neutral Layers

Neutrals are the backbone of any minimalist look, and they are especially forgiving on a crowded train or a brisk walk to the office. Cream, stone, charcoal, and soft navy act as a visual exhale, letting your silhouette and the quality of the fabric do all the talking. Layering is where the real magic lives. A fine knit worn beneath a sharp blazer adapts effortlessly from a chilly platform to an overheated open-plan office. Choose fabrics with natural stretch and genuine wrinkle resistance so you arrive looking composed rather than creased. The discipline of a limited palette also makes packing for business trips nearly effortless, since every piece you own already speaks the same quiet, coordinated language.

Footwear That Works Overtime

The commute is won or lost at the feet, yet shoes are the most overlooked part of a minimalist plan. A disciplined approach favors one or two versatile pairs that balance comfort and polish without compromise. A clean leather loafer or a streamlined white trainer handles pavement and meetings with equal grace, while a low block-heel ankle boot adds quiet authority on presentation days. Invest in cushioned insoles and proper weatherproofing so your shoes survive rain, stairs, and long corridors without complaint. Keep a dedicated pair of indoor flats at your desk if your route is long, but resist the temptation to over-collect. Two considered pairs will out-serve a shelf of impulsive buys, and they will look better doing it.

Accessorizing Without the Noise

Minimalism is not the absence of accessories; it is the presence of intention. A single watch, one pair of small gold hoops, and a structured tote can complete a commute outfit without a single distracting flourish. The trick is restraint with genuine purpose: choose pieces that are functional as well as beautiful. A crossbody strap on your work bag frees both hands for a coffee and a handrail. A silk scarf knotted at the neck doubles as warmth and a point of visual interest. When every accessory earns its keep, you project composure rather than clutter, and your morning routine stays light on both physical and mental weight.

Transitioning From Desk to Dinner

The true test of a minimalist commute wardrobe is the impromptu evening plan that appears at four in the afternoon. Rather than rushing home to change, build your day around pieces that pivot gracefully. Swap the structured blazer for a soft cardigan, let a bold lip or a spritz of fragrance signal the shift, and trade loafers for the ankle boots already tucked in your bag. A capsule built on neutrals makes evening transitions nearly invisible because the foundation is already elegant. By the time you settle into dinner, no one will guess you came straight from a nine-hour workday. That seamless ease is the quiet luxury minimalism was always promising.
